Exploring Las Vegas by car
#wheretogo Cruising down the Las Vegas Strip in your own set of wheels? Let me tell you, it's a ride you won't forget. I recently took my car for a spin along this glittering boulevard, and it was a whole new way to experience the city that never sleeps.
Picture this: you've got the neon lights, colossal signs, and all those crazy-cool buildings stretching as far as the eye can see. It's like a non-stop light show, and you're right in the middle of it. You won't stop reaching for your camera – trust me, every turn offers a new photo op.
One of the coolest things about it is the freedom. You get to explore at your own pace. Want to check out the Bellagio's fountains? Go for it. Feel like seeing a mini Eiffel Tower at Paris Las Vegas? Just drive over.
But it's not just about the buildings; it's about the people too. The Strip is like a giant stage. You'll see tourists from all over, street performers in wild costumes, and people having the time of their lives. The energy is infectious, and you're right in the middle of it.
Okay, okay, I won't sugarcoat it – the traffic can get crazy, especially during the busy times. But here's the thing: the experience is one of a kind. It's a wild and immersive journey that puts you in the heart of all that Vegas magic.
To sum it up, driving along the Las Vegas Strip is an adventure you've got to try. It's convenient, it's a feast for the eyes, and you'll be part of the vibrant, crazy vibe that makes Vegas, well, Vegas. So, put the pedal to the metal and take it all in!
